怎么用python语句新建数据库并且成功访问
要使用Python语句新建数据库并成功访问,您需要使用一个适用于Python的数据库管理系统(如MySQL或SQLite)。下面是一个使用SQLite数据库的示例:
- 首先,您需要安装Python的SQLite模块。可以使用以下命令来安装:
pip install sqlite3
- 导入sqlite3模块:
import sqlite3
- 使用
connect()函数连接到SQLite数据库并创建一个数据库文件:
conn = sqlite3.connect('database.db')
- 创建一个游标对象,用于执行SQL语句:
cursor = conn.cursor()
- 使用游标对象执行SQL语句来创建表:
cursor.execute('''CREATE TABLE IF NOT EXISTS users
(id INTEGER PRIMARY KEY AUTOINCREMENT,
name TEXT NOT NULL,
age INTEGER NOT NULL)''')
- 插入一些数据到表中:
cursor.execute("INSERT INTO users (name, age) VALUES ('John', 30)")
cursor.execute("INSERT INTO users (name, age) VALUES ('Alice', 25)")
- 提交更改到数据库:
conn.commit()
- 关闭游标和数据库连接:
cursor.close()
conn.close()
至此,您已经成功创建了一个SQLite数据库并插入了一些数据。您可以通过类似的connect()函数来连接到数据库并执行其他操作来访问数据库
原文地址: https://www.cveoy.top/t/topic/hLQA 著作权归作者所有。请勿转载和采集!